Article: United Airlines pilots oppose plans for low-cost airline.

AIRLINE INDUSTRY INFORMATION-(C)1997-2003 M2 COMMUNICATIONS LTD

United Airlines' pilots are reportedly opposed to the carrier's plans to create a separate low-cost carrier.

The pilots have said that they recognise that a low-cost unit within United is important for the airline's recovery strategy, but have accused the airline of seeking to break up the company. The pilots have stated ...
